About the Fair Work Commission

The Fair Work Commission (FWC) is the national workplace relations tribunal. It is an independent body with power to carry out a range of functions relating to:
• The safety net of minimum wages and employment conditions
• Enterprise bargaining
• Industrial action
• Dispute Resolution
• Anti-bullying
• Termination of Employment
• Registered Organisations

FWC is a statutory authority with offices in each State and Territory. The majority of staff are based in Melbourne, Sydney and Brisbane.
FWC staff are employed under the provisions of the Public Service Act 1999, which means they must uphold the APS Values and abide by the APS Code of Conduct. Employment conditions are set out in the Fair Work Commission Enterprise Agreement 2017- 2020.
